Get Happy! is still my all time favorite Elvis Costello record. Over the years I've played it thousands of times and I'm still not sick of it. My most beloved cuts on the album are Opportunity, Secondary Modern, New Amsterdam, & Riot Act...which are the songs that don't fit into the soul music theme of the album. Don't get me wrong, I still enjoy the Stax/Motown themed songs on Get Happy!. There isn't a single throwaway song on the entire album.

I really like the rougher sound of Nick Lowe's production on Get Happy!, which makes the Attractions sound more like a bar band than a "new wave" band. Lowe's production on the Attraction's previous album Armed Forces was almost too slick.

I own the Rhino issued edition of Get Happy! which includes Girls Talk as the 21st song on the album. The UK edition of Get Happy! always had Girls Talk as the 21st song, if I'm not mistaken.
